Ride Quality
The ride’s quality is crucial, but how crucial will be determined by your own personal preferences and what you’d like to use the scooter for. The ride quality is determined by numerous factors like the dimensions and the type of wheel and suspension as well as the weight of the scooter, the size of the deck as and the length of the handlebar as well as the stem.
The primary factors that impact the quality of ride is suspension and tyres.
Motor Power
The power, commonly known in the form of “torque” is what the motor’s power will generate in response to various factors. The torque is vital since it determines the ability of the scooter to speed up. Battery Capacity and Charging Time
The typical charging time is five and one-half hours. The majority of consumer electric scooters require between 3 and 8 hours to fully charged. The scooters with the shortest charging times will take less than an minute to fully charge. The one with the longest charge time can take more than a whole day to recharge.
Also keep in mind that SPEED is a factor that must be paired with battery capacity. The more quickly that you move, the less your range will be.
For heavier riders Battery capacity of 10AH minimum is recommended
The Maximum Load The Scooter can handle and More
In general – heavier riders should consider scooters with motor power exceeding 500W to ensure that the scooter has enough power to tackle steep slopes, but lighter riders should be aware of the implications of buying the heavy-weight scooter.
The purchase of an electric scooter involves many considerations – your height and weight must be considered.
Taller riders might find short stem scooters uncomfortable heavier riders might find lower power scooters struggle on inclines. Smaller or lighter riders may find huge heavy scooters unwieldly to ride and carry.
